Title: SX-200 | Call Forward Keeps Getting Deleted
Post by: TooJive on May 14, 2018, 05:40:11 PM
Hey guys

I am having an extension call forward to a cell phone in an SX-200. When I get it programmed and tested, a day or 2 later it gets deleted and I have to recreate it. All the callforwarding options in the same COS are enabled. Not sure what could be causing this. Any help is much appreciated!

Is there actually a telephone connected to this port? If there is, does there need to be?

Does this system have an Attendant Console like a 5540 or Superconsole 1000? There is an option in the Attendant Function Menu labeled "CAN ALL CWD", which in reality means "Cancel All Call Forwarding in the system without exception"... I remember years ago before there was a Voicemail reroute in form 19 and you used to call forward no answer each phone to the voicemail hunt group manually, this was a serious pain in the a$$ option.

Yes... The console can cancel all call forwarding in the system. It's under Function - Att Function - More, I think...

I can't remember if you remove the COS option "Attendant Call Forward Setup" if it removes that setting or not, it seems to me that there it does not and there is no way to disable that "feature".
